About The Position

The State of Connecticut, Department of Administrative Services (DAS) is currently accepting applications for the position of Office Assistant within the Fleet Operations Division. The fleet operations is responsible for managing, maintaining, and assigning the motor vehicles owned by the state, for employees' use in conducting official business. As an Office Assistant, you will provide a full range of clerical tasks supporting the Fleet Operations Division, that may include but is not limited to: phone coverage, mail handling, and many other clerical support duties. The role of Office Assistant performs a full range of clerical duties, in the areas of typing, filing, correspondence, report writing, interpersonal, processing, and performs related duties as required. Requirements

  • Two (2) years of general clerical work experience.
  • Knowledge of office systems and procedures including proper telephone usage and filing.
  • Interpersonal skills.
  • Oral and written communication skills.
  • Skills in performing arithmetical computations.
  • Ability to perform a full range of clerical tasks.
  • Ability to operate office equipment which includes computers, tablets, and other electronic equipment.
  • Ability to operate office suite software.
  • Ability to schedule and prioritize workflow.
  • Ability to read and interpret complex instructions.

Responsibilities

  • Provides a full range of clerical tasks supporting the Fleet Operations Division.
  • Handles phone coverage.
  • Handles mail.
  • Performs other clerical support duties.
  • Performs a full range of clerical duties in the areas of typing, filing, correspondence, report writing, interpersonal, and processing.
  • Types a variety of materials.
  • Enters and retrieves data on computers, tablets, and other electronic equipment.
  • Sets up and maintains office procedures, filing and indexing systems and forms.
  • Composes routine correspondence.
  • Compiles and generates recurrent technical, statistical or financial reports requiring judgment in the selection and presentation of data.
  • Provides general information and referral services in response to citizen complaints or questions regarding an agency's services or authority.
  • Responds to inquiries from other work units or departments/agencies.
  • Applies agency policies and state statutes and regulations in determining case status or responding to requests for procedural assistance.
  • May lead lower level employees in carrying out assigned clerical functions.
  • Maintains calendars of due dates and initiates recurring work or special clerical projects accordingly.
  • Processes a variety of documents in determining routine case status.
  • Exercises discretion in choosing appropriate follow through procedures within defined guidelines including assembling and reviewing incoming materials for accuracy, completeness and conformance to established guidelines and agency policy and procedures, verifying information through use of internal resources and contacts with sender and other work units and soliciting additional information as required by correspondence.
  • Processes purchase requisitions/purchase orders for subsequent action.
  • Prepares payment lists and billing invoices.
  • Receives shipments of materials and matches/verifies shipment or billing invoices against original purchase orders.
  • Maintains files, journals or account ledgers by posting credits, expenditures, interest, etc.
  • Figures payments, costs, discounts and adjustments using prescribed methods and formulas.
  • Receives monies in various forms such as cash, checks and money orders and prepares for deposit.
  • Maintains inventory and orders supplies.
  • Uses a variety of electronic equipment to perform job functions.
  • Performs related duties as required.
